Labour Market Impact Assessment

Before recruiting foreign labour, firms must typically obtain government approval. This is done through what is now known as a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A). It was formerly known as a Labour Market Opinion (LMO). When a Canadian business cannot find a local Canadian worker to fill the position, an LMIA is issued.

The primary method of establishing this is by posting job openings in Canada, and it is to make an effort to recruit Canadians. Therefore, it demonstrates that the candidates lack the necessary skills for the position being provided.

There are two categories—high-wage and low-wage. They will used to classify job positions under the new LMIA system. Jobs deemed high if the pay is at or above the provincial median wage where they will done, and it is considered low if it is lower than the provincial median wage.

How to Hire if an LMIA is Required

Thanks to the Temporary Foreign Worker Program (TFWP), you can hire. To fill labour and talent shortages, you can employ temporary foreign workers. You must deliver a copy of the confirmation letter after issuing the LMIA. Every temporary foreign worker will receive this. Then, each of them must apply for a work permit.
